如何从字符串中解析 LocalTime,例如 mm:ss.S 格式的“10:38.0”?我很难改变格式。
public static LocalTime parseTime(String time) {
return localTime = LocalTime.parse(time, DateTimeFormatter.ofPattern("mm:ss.S"));
}
Run Code Online (Sandbox Code Playgroud)
出现错误
java.time.format.Parsed java.time.format.DateTimeParseException 类型的 ISO:无法解析文本 '10:38.2':无法从 TemporalAccessor 获取 LocalTime:{MinuteOfHour=10,MicroOfSecond=200000,MilliOfSecond=200,NanoOfSecond =200000000,秒数=38},